GREETINGS TO N.Z.
AMERICAN PRESIDENT (Per Press Association.) WELLINGTON, this day. ; The Prime Minister, the Rt. Hon. P. Fraser, has received a cable message from President Roosevelt in reply ,to the season’s greetings extended by Mr. Fraser. The text of Mr. Roosevelt’s message is as follows: “I grefitly ap'jSrhciafq your cordial message for Christmas and the new year and in turn extend my good wishes to you and the people of New Zealand. We are proud to be associated with the people of New Zealand arid the British com monwealth in defence of human, freedom arid liberty, and I am supremely confident of thfe final triumph of opr great cause (signed) Franklin D. Roosevelt.” v
